If you've been watching the "For Sale" signs in Aldershot South, here's what's actually happening with houses. The HonestDoor Price is sitting at an average of $1,651,501, up 1.53% from the previous period. That's not a headline number - that's real movement in your equity.
Nine days on market. That is not a slow market taking a breather - that is a sprint. Nearby Maple is averaging 12 days, so we are moving noticeably faster. On the Hamilton leaderboard, Aldershot South houses rank 1 out of 69 for price, meaning we sit at the very top of the expensive pile. Days-on-market rank is 4 out of 45, which puts us among the fastest-selling neighbourhoods in the entire city.
The one honest flag: recent price change is down 0.59%, and the growth rate ranks 138 out of 203 Hamilton neighbourhoods. So while buyers are still competing hard, the longer-term growth pace is sitting below average. Worth knowing before you price too aggressively.
The condo picture is a bit more cautious right now, and we'd rather tell you straight than dress it up.
Condos here are sitting below average on the Hamilton growth leaderboard, and the 3-month trend is pointing down. Nearby Aldershot Central condos are averaging $563,640, which means even a neighbouring pocket is outperforming us right now. If you own a condo in Aldershot South, this is not a panic moment - but it is a "pay attention" moment.
